The 2023 Mini Clubman Is One for the Last of Us

Posted on August 21, 2023August 27, 2023 By bot

It may be in many ways a golden age for automotive performance and capability, but for station wagon fans, these days can feel positively apocalyptic. Once staples of the American roadways, they’ve slowly but surely been pushed aside as a family vehicle of choice: first by minivans, then by traditional SUVs, then by crossovers, and now, arguably, by pickup trucks.
